About This Book
A chance meeting between a man and a woman on a European train sets in motion a web of personal and social entanglements. The narrative shifts between a shadowed ancestral house and more public settings to explore family obligations, inherited temperament, and changing fortunes. Characters pursue marriage, ambition, and respectability while hiding desires and compromises that strain loyalties and reputations. The story unfolds through episodes of flirtation, strategic alliances, professional rivalry, and scandal, exposing hypocrisy and the costs of social advancement. Structured in distinct parts and chapters, the work traces how private choices reshape public standing and lead to unexpected consequences.
